How India’s Food Fortification Programs Are Rewriting Public Health Outcomes

Iron deficiency anemia affects over 50% of Indian women and 30% of children, according to the National Family Health Survey (2022). Food fortification—adding iron to staples like wheat flour and rice—has emerged as a scalable intervention. However, its success hinges on addressing regional disparities, ensuring quality control, and aligning with local dietary habits.

Contraindications & When to Consult a Doctor

Iron fortification is generally safe but contraindicated in individuals with hemochromatosis, a genetic disorder causing iron overload. Symptoms like joint pain, fatigue, and abdominal pain warrant immediate medical evaluation. Those on anticoagulants should consult a physician, as excess iron may interact with medications.
